









HDPE geomembrane (high-density polyethylene geomembrane) is a waterproof and anti-seepage material made by blowing or calendering process. It has excellent anti-seepage performance, chemical corrosion resistance, aging resistance and mechanical strength, and is widely used in anti-seepage projects such as landfills, reservoirs, artificial lakes, sewage treatment pools, and mine tailings ponds.

Properties | Test Method | GMSH050 | GMSH075 | GMSH100 | GMSH150 | GMSH300 |
■ Thickness | ASTM D5199 | 0.50 mm | 0.75 mm | 1.00 mm | 1.50 mm | 3.00 mm |
■ Density | ASTM D1505 | 0.940 g/cc | 0.940 g/cc | 0.940 g/cc | 0.940 g/cc | 0.940 g/cc |
Tensile Properties | ||||||
■ Yield strength ■ Break strength ■ Yield elongation ■ Break elongation | ASTM D6693 Type IV
| 7 kN/m 13 kN/m 12% 700% | 11 kN/m 20 kN/m 12% 700% | 15 kN/m 27 kN/m 12% 700% | 22 kN/m 40 kN/m 12% 700% | 41 kN/m 82 kN/m 12% 700% |
■ Tear Resistance | ASTM D1004 | 62 N | 93 N | 125 N | 187 N | 375 N |
■ Puncture Resistance | ASTM D4833 | 160 N | 240 N | 320 N | 480 N | 960 N |
■ Stress Crack Resistance | ASTM D5397 | 500 hrs | 500 hrs | 500 hrs | 500 hrs | 500 hrs |
■ Carbon Black Content | ASTM D1603 | 2.0% | 2.0% | 2.0% | 2.0% | 2.0% |
■ Carbon Black Dispersion | ASTM D5596 | For 10 different views:9 in Categories 1 or 2 and 1 in Category 3 | ||||
■ Oxidative Induction Time (OIT) | ASTM D3895 | 100 min. | 100 min. | 100 min. | 100 min. | 100 min. |
■ UV Resistance High Pressure OIT retained after 1600hrs |
ASTM D5885 |
50% |
50% |
50% |
50% |
50% |
Dimensions | ||||||
■ Roll Width (m) | 7 | 7 | 7 | 7 | 7 | |
■ Roll Length (m) | 420 | 280 | 210 | 140 | 50 |
